TROUBLESHOOTING
PROBLEM POSSIBLE CAUSES WHAT TO DO
Espresso runs out
around the edge of

and/or
Portalter not inserted in
the group head correctly.
Ensure portalter is rotated to the right
until the handle is past the centre and is
securely locked in place. Rotating past the
centre will not damage the silicone seal.

out of the group
head during an
extraction.
There are coee
grounds around the
lter basket rim.
Clean excess coee from the rim of the
lter basket to ensure a proper seal in
group head.
Filter basket rim is
wet or underside of
portalter lugs are wet.
Wet surfaces reduce
the friction required
to hold the portalter
in place whilst under
pressure during an
extraction.
Always ensure lter basket and portalter
are dried thoroughly before lling with
coee, tamping and inserting into the group
head.
Too much coee in the
lter basket.
Trim coee dose using the RAZOR™
dosing tool after tamping.


sticking to the
shower screen.
This is normal and
happens occasionally.
The dry puck feature
creates a slight
vacuum on top of the
coee puck which
will occasionally hold
the puck against the
shower screen instead
of leaving it in the lter
basket.
